About Northline Post

Global technology and markets, from the north.

Northline Post covers the companies building the physical technology the next decade runs on: Chinese carmakers and the electric vehicle industry first, then batteries and energy, semiconductors, AI hardware and robotics. The angle is consistently commercial — what a technology costs, who is actually making money from it, and which numbers give the story away.

It is written from Denmark, which shapes the coverage. European exposure to Chinese manufacturing, tariffs, energy prices and the supply chains that connect them get more attention here than they would from a desk in California.

What you'll find

Delivery numbers, margins and valuation multiples are curated by hand from company filings, with a source attached to every figure. Prices shown inside articles are snapshots from the date of publication, never live.
